summaryrefslogtreecommitdiff
Commit message (Expand)AuthorAgeFilesLines
* Replace ath based mutexes by gpgrt based locks.Werner Koch2014-01-1626-687/+90
* ecc: Fix _gcry_mpi_ec_p_new to allow secp256k1.NIIBE Yutaka2014-01-152-14/+4
* PBKDF2: Use gcry_md_reset to speed up calculation.Milan Broz2014-01-141-7/+9
* Add DCO entry for Milan Broz.Werner Koch2014-01-141-0/+3
* Fix macro conflict in NetBSDWerner Koch2014-01-131-9/+11
* Use internal malloc function in fips.cWerner Koch2014-01-131-1/+1
* Update NEWS.Werner Koch2014-01-131-0/+12
* Truncate hash values for ECDSA signature schemeDmitry Eremin-Solenikov2014-01-135-63/+129
* Add GOST R 34.10-2012 curves proposed by TC26Dmitry Eremin-Solenikov2014-01-132-1/+36
* Add GOST R 34.10-2001 curves per RFC4357Dmitry Eremin-Solenikov2014-01-132-2/+40
* Fix typo in search_oidDmitry Eremin-Solenikov2014-01-131-1/+1
* Add MD2-HMAC calculation supportDmitry Eremin-Solenikov2014-01-132-0/+9
* Add a function to retrieve algorithm used by MAC handlerDmitry Eremin-Solenikov2014-01-139-1/+37
* Correct formatting of gcry_mac_get_algo_keylen documentationDmitry Eremin-Solenikov2014-01-131-1/+1
* ecc: Make a macro shorter.Werner Koch2014-01-135-23/+44
* Fix assembly division checkJussi Kivilinna2014-01-121-1/+1
* Add secp256k1 curve.NIIBE Yutaka2014-01-123-1/+36
* Fix constant division for AMD64 assembly on Solaris/x86Jussi Kivilinna2014-01-121-1/+37
* Use the generic autogen.sh script.Werner Koch2014-01-103-82/+213
* Move all helper scripts to build-aux/Werner Koch2014-01-1018-54/+58
* Fix another minor typo.Werner Koch2014-01-081-1/+1
* Typo fixes.Werner Koch2014-01-082-2/+2
* Add blowfish/serpent ARM assembly files to Makefile.amJussi Kivilinna2013-12-301-2/+2
* Add AMD64 assembly implementation for arcfourJussi Kivilinna2013-12-304-1/+132
* Parse /proc/cpuinfo for ARM HW featuresJussi Kivilinna2013-12-301-2/+53
* Fix buggy/incomplete detection of AVX/AVX2 supportJussi Kivilinna2013-12-302-3/+47
* Change utf-8 copyright characters to '(C)'Jussi Kivilinna2013-12-1840-40/+40
* Add ARM/NEON implementation for SHA-1Jussi Kivilinna2013-12-184-1/+534
* Improve performance of SHA-512/ARM/NEON implementationJussi Kivilinna2013-12-182-124/+252
* Add AVX and AVX2/BMI implementations for SHA-256Jussi Kivilinna2013-12-187-8/+1405
* Add AVX and AVX/BMI2 implementations for SHA-1Jussi Kivilinna2013-12-175-2/+893
* SHA-1/SSSE3: Improve performance on large buffersJussi Kivilinna2013-12-172-21/+64
* Add bulk processing for hash transform functionsJussi Kivilinna2013-12-1712-58/+208
* Open new development branch.Werner Koch2013-12-163-4/+6
* Post release updates.Werner Koch2013-12-162-1/+5
* Release 1.6.0.libgcrypt-1.6.0Werner Koch2013-12-164-9/+27
* doc: Change yat2m to allow arbitrary condition names.Werner Koch2013-12-161-107/+266
* tests: Add SHA-512 to the long hash test.Werner Koch2013-12-163-3/+33
* Add configure option --enable-large-data-tests.Werner Koch2013-12-164-5/+38
* random: Call random progress handler more often.Werner Koch2013-12-161-7/+13
* cipher: Normalize the MPIs used as input to secret key functions.Werner Koch2013-12-163-2/+18
* Change dummy variable in mpih-div.c to mpi_limb_t typeJussi Kivilinna2013-12-161-2/+2
* Remove duplicate gcry_mac_hd_t typedefJussi Kivilinna2013-12-161-1/+0
* Use u64 for CCM data lengthsJussi Kivilinna2013-12-156-20/+118
* tests: Prevent rare failure of gcry_pk_decrypt test.Werner Koch2013-12-141-16/+59
* Minor fixes to SHA assembly implementationsJussi Kivilinna2013-12-145-28/+9
* SHA-1/SSSE3: Do not check for Intel syntax assembly supportJussi Kivilinna2013-12-142-3/+1
* Convert SHA-1 SSSE3 implementation from mixed asm&C to pure asmJussi Kivilinna2013-12-133-320/+379
* SHA-1: Add SSSE3 implementationJussi Kivilinna2013-12-134-2/+365
* Add missing register clearing in to SHA-256 and SHA-512 assemblyJussi Kivilinna2013-12-134-0/+49